January Weather in Cataguases, Brazil

Last updated: August 22, 2025

In January, the average temperature in Cataguases, Brazil hovers around 26°C (79°F), with a pleasant range between a minimum of 18°C (65°F) and a maximum of 35°C (95°F). Expect 154 mm (6.0 in) of precipitation spread over 13 days, contributing to an average humidity of 83%. January UV Index in Cataguases

In Cataguases in January, the maximum UV index is 16, which corresponds to an extreme Exposure Category. The time to burn is just 10 minutes, making it crucial to take protective measures. For detailed information, you can refer to the Hourly UV Index in Cataguases.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
